10/189 added to 109/4 in Fraction Form

The result of 10/189 added to 109/4 is: 27 229/756

Why Simplify Fractions?

Simplifying fractions makes them easier to work with and understand. A fraction is in its simplest form when the numerator and denominator have no common factors other than 1.

To simplify a fraction, divide both the numerator and denominator by their greatest common divisor (GCD).
